Lil Wayne Lands 'Suicide Watch' Job in Prison
Celebrity

Serving his time in prison for gun possession charge since March, the 27-year-old rapper has now worked on 'suicide watch' in prison although he is paid with low salary.

AceShowbiz - Rapper Lil Wayne is on "suicide watch" in prison - he's has been asked to keep an eye on desperate fellow inmates, according to his ex-girlfriend. The 27-year-old rapper, real name Dwayne Carter Jr., began his year-long stint for gun possession in maximum-security New York prison Rikers Island in March, and he has been given a big responsibility behind bars.

Antonia 'Toya' Johnson, the mother of Wayne's 11-year-old daughter, tells Us Magazine, "Wayne has a job. They got him on suicide watch for other prisoners. He watches the crazy prisoners and makes sure they don't kill themselves. He likes the job, even though they don't pay him much."

She insists her ex is "doing OK" and "getting along with everybody".
